http://bgr.com/2013/07/18/nokia-earnings-analysis-q2-2013/Overall, Nokia's second-quarter sales and earnings came in above expectations thanks to the strong network unit performance. But the smartphone unit volume was light at 7.4 million units, about 700,000 below consensus. The real surprise came from the smartphone average sales price (ASP), which plunged from 191 euros to 157 euros in just three months. This implies that sales of the flagship Lumia 920 dropped sharply, while demand moved rapidly towards the cheap Lumia 520. This might be OK in the long run, if Nokia can ship big volumes of low-end smartphones with decent margins.
